UnicUnicorn Records, the Canadian label that brought us Spaced Out, is       releasing some of the best contemporary jazz-rock. Addison Project       is a band assembled by Richard Addison, who played bass on the       first two Mystery albums, and has a lot of studio experience in       Montreal.

 This is sophisticated progressive fusion, sounding very modern in  that there is a groove to most of the songs, propelled by Addison’s  throbbing bass lines. And some of this sounds like what Frank Zappa  might be doing today (if the whole being-dead issue had been  resolved).
